Connexin43 Modulation of Osteoblast/Osteocyte Apoptosis: A Potential Therapeutic Target?

GAP JUNCTIONS ARE arrays of transcellular channels that allow aqueous continuity between the cytoplasms of two adjacent cells. A gap junction channel is established by docking of two “hemichannels” or connexons present on juxtaposed cells, thus forming a transcellular conduit through which ions and small molecules can diffuse from cell to cell.
